Simply put, the San Diego Chargers need to fire Norv Turner. I have never been a fan of Turner and was always against the firing of Marty Schottenheimer. Marty was never able to lead the Chargers to a playoff win, unlike Turner, but he was a hard nosed coach that made sure his players were ready to play. Under Schottenheimer, LaDainian Tomlinson was a beast and probably the best running back in the league, while Norv Turner’s scheme helped in the decline of this great player. The one great thing that has come out of Turner coaching the Chargers is the growth of Philip Rivers. Turner is an offensive guru and he deserves a lot of credit for the development of Rivers. Even with this fact, the Chargers can not win the Super Bowl under Norv Turner.

Under Norv, the Chargers have gone 6-9 in the first five games over the past three seasons. Yes, they have always recovered to make the playoffs but this really tells us something about Norv Turner. He does not have the ability to get his players ready. I have heard from sources that unlike Marty, Turner would allow players to skip practice and still allow them to play on Sundays. Marty, on the other hand, had a simple rule: you don’t practice, you don’t play. There are always instances when players make a big deal of minor injuries and ask to sit out of practice for this reason, then a few days later they are given the opportunity to play on Sunday. This allows the players to be lazy and unprepared, something that Marty was very strict about. I have heard from people that many players had lost respect for Turner and that they just did not believe in him and if true, would be a huge reason for their lack of Super Bowl striving success.

The Chargers have a very favorable first six game schedule and should of gone 6-0 through all games. Obviously they are now 0-1 and if they lose another game within those first six, they should highly consider getting rid of Norv. If they lose three, they definitely need to get rid of him. The Chargers have so much talent, and although their window is close to closing, with a hard nosed coach, they have the ability to finally get to and win the Super Bowl. So 2-4, consider firing Turner, and if anything worse than 3-3, FIRE HIM! I am sick of seeing the Chargers start slow and lose “easy” games. Norv Turner, get your crap together or get out of San Diego.
